About Counterflow


There are two kinds of people in this world simply put; those who jump and those who don’t; those who go all in and those who hold back. We create a path for our clients not to merely take the proverbial leap of faith, but to take a calculated and confident leap for success. Other advertising agencies might want to push their vision of a company onto someone. Here at Counterflow no two clients are the same so we don’t treat them that way. We know how to market across a plethora of industries from law firms to auto detailers and builds a strategy that is right for the client. It is our job to make sense of it all and increase our client’s value in as many ways possible.


We approach every project differently. There is no template that is a one-size-fits-all in marketing, and if someone tells you there is, run. Run as fast as you can. While each project is handled differently, we still take the steps to make sure that we are doing what we can to make your business the best it can be.


First, before all else, we must understand exactly what it is with your business that we need to solve. It is very often that a client does not know the questions to ask us. It is our job to ask the important questions and divulge a plan to figure out the problem.


We diverge from our competition because we really take the time to know our client, and even more know their customer. This is why we work well with any company, even though we have never been to your city or country. We take the time to understand our client and their customer inside and out. Once we can answer why the problems are occurring then we can start to take action in correcting the issues.


Once we can understand why things are the way there are, and why the customer thinks, feels, acts or breathes the way they do, we then arrive at what needs to be done. Even though the issue and cause might be apparent it is essential that the correction to the problem is applied correctly, in the way that will best benefit your business. Often times, the what is the easy part, the how can be much harder. At Counterflow, we show the client how we will move forward to solve the problem.


Measurability in all industries is one of the most crucial components. It is fundamentally impossible to see progress and contribution from individual components of the business without putting in place tools to evaluate performance. It all starts with being able to measure the present.

We cannot make informed decisions and research the next steps to execute without knowing where business currently sits. Before making any changes, we measure the current performance of simple business metrics. Once we can take a look at some of the basic marketing metrics of your business, we can then get to work and set the essential milestones that we want to reach. We will also put in place measurable analytics tools to be able to evaluate our performance and work hard to break records of our own doing. If you can’t measure it, then it is not relevant.

Things we can do for you

Here at Counterflow Marketing we believe that everything is set in motion for a reason. In business, it is all about the execution.  We execute and deliver results far above expectations.
Join us as we fight the current, for you.
Sam P.
Auto Shop Manager

Geoff and his team at Counterflow Marketing are so easy to work with! Their SEO setup has increased business dramatically. I’ve gotten more leads than ever before. I even had to hire a new sales guy to manage all the new customers. I highly recommend Counterflow to grow your business!

Lara H.
Business Owner

Counterflow Marketing gave my website a facelift so now it’s so easy to navigate and all my services are on the front page of my site! I’ve been booking more clients than ever through my site and it’s all thanks to Counterflow Marketing.

Jason F.
Business Owner

Counterflow Marketing does it right. When I started advertising with Counterflow my sales went up 300%! These guys know how to target the right people and get them to your business. If you want more customers, Counterflow can get them through your door.

Jake R.
Event Coordinator

When it comes to throwing events, Counterflow Marketing will make it happen! They successfully coordinated every aspect of our company’s party from booking the talent to ordering catering and making sure everything ran smoothly. If you want to throw a badass party, hit up Counterflow Marketing.